Removal: first i file the polygel off so that a thin layer remains. After that i soak them in aceton (there are many ways to do that, just look on youtube). After 10 min i try to see if i can scrape them off, if not i repeat soaking them.
At this moment im trying a different technique: after filing the nail i put on a soaking gel (bought it on s h e i n), let it sit and scrape it off (repeat).
Hope this helps.
